Quarterly Planning Note — Customer Concentration

Department heads: Torvale Systems now derives 46% of recurring revenue from Brinmark Logistics, up from 31% last year. Any contraction there would strain cash reserves materially. We will diversify via the Sablewood pipeline and tighten contract terms at renewal. Please model exposure scenarios for your units before the planning offsite. The mitigation strategy is summarised in the confidential note that follows.

management briefing: Project Ulavan slips by two quarters because of the staffing delay.

# Notes for the weekly eng sync: the Brindlewood build farm has been
# showing clock skew of up to 40 seconds between agents, which caused
# signed artifact timestamps to fail validation in Lanternway CI twice
# last sprint. We now sync every agent against the Pellmont time service
# before each pipeline run, and the client below enforces a 5-second
# tolerance window. The client authenticates to Pellmont with the key
# on the following line.

service key, yadug-bajog: zpat3_pou

Handover — Brightfen firmware channel

Taking over from me: the Brightfen OTA channel pushes signed firmware to Lanternet thermostats. Signing runs on an isolated builder; the public key is pinned on-device. Rollouts are staged at 1%, 10%, 100%, with automatic halt on a 2% failure rate. For the security review: verify the manifest signature check can't be skipped via the legacy v1 endpoint — I disabled it but didn't delete it. The channel service currently runs with these settings.

config for yajep-tafof:
[rusath]
team = julmir
access_code = ac_fe37fd
host = rusath.novactech.test
port = 8000
owner = pelmir.weneth
peer = oliwyn.olvarqdyn.internal

Open requisitions are suspended, not cancelled; internal transfers remain possible with divisional sign-off. The freeze reflects slower-than-forecast uptake of the Larkspur platform and a deliberate decision to protect margin through year-end. Department heads should review headcount plans by the fifteenth and flag any role whose absence creates compliance or safety risk. Please treat the following context as strictly confidential until the board confirms direction.

confidential, kagep-kahof: Druokax Systems plans to lower the Ulaath list price by 53 percent in March.